How many rows a SQL table can hold?

How many rows a SQL table can hold?

The internal representation of a MySQL table has a maximum row size limit of 65,535 bytes, even if the storage engine is capable of supporting larger rows. BLOB and TEXT columns only contribute 9 to 12 bytes toward the row size limit because their contents are stored separately from the rest of the row.

How do I reduce the size of my SQL server database?

Use SQL Server Management Studio

  1. In Object Explorer, connect to an instance of the SQL Server Database Engine, and then expand that instance.
  2. Expand Databases, and then right-click the database that you want to shrink.
  3. Point to Tasks, point to Shrink, and then select Database. Database.
  4. Select OK.

How do you find the total size of a table in Oracle?

select segment_name,segment_type, sum(bytes/1024/1024/1024) GB from dba_segments where segment_name=’&Your_Table_Name’ group by segment_name,segment_type; Storage.

How large should my database be?

A database should not contain more than 1,000 tables; Each individual table should not exceed 1 GB in size or 20 million rows; The total size of all the tables in a database should not exceed 2 GB.

How do I find the index size and table size in SQL Server?

  1. SELECT. tbl. NAME AS Table_Name, s.
  2. p. rows AS Row_Count, SUM(au.
  3. (SUM(au. total_pages) – SUM(au. used_pages)) * 8 AS Unused_SpaceKB.
  4. INNER JOIN. sys. indexes ind ON tbl.
  5. sys. partitions p ON ind. OBJECT_ID = p.
  6. LEFT OUTER JOIN. sys. schemas s ON tbl.
  7. tbl. is_ms_shipped = 0. AND ind.
  8. tbl. Name, s. Name, p.

How to find table size in SQL Server?

Get size of tables in SQL Server. To get a rough view of how many rows, total, used and unused space each table has, in a sql server database you can run the following query: Another way is using the stored procedure ` sp_spaceused ` which displays the number of rows, disk space reserved, and disk space used by a table, indexed view, or Service

What is the size of a SQL Server table?

Work around SQL Server maximum columns limit 1024 and 8kb record size. Warning: The table “Test” has been created, but its maximum row size exceeds the allowed maximum of 8060 bytes. INSERT or UPDATE to this table will fail if the resulting row exceeds the size limit.

How to split table into multiple tables using SQL?

– To organize a set of tables such that you can execute Partial Backup operations for them in one step. – In order to move specific data to volumes with faster disks. This means, you may have identified tables which are hot tables and require more stringent response times. – To simply reorganize tables for better performance.

How do you select a table in SQL?

Use the SELECT statement to query data from a table.

  • Specify one or more column names after the SELECT clause to which you want to query data.
  • Specify the name of the table from which you want to query data.